Consumer Financial Services

NERA's economists have extensive experience with consumer financial services issues. Bank and non-bank consumer financial services providers rely on NERA to provide expert analysis, testimony, and advisory services in the following contexts:

  • Litigation
  • Enforcement actions
  • Supervisory examinations
  • Regulatory analysis

Our deep practical expertise cuts across the financial services industry, including banking, servicing, credit cards, money transmitter, payday loans, mortgage origination and securitization, and investment products. Many of NERA's economists have direct regulatory experience, having held key positions at government agencies including the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au, the Federal Trade Commission, the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ation, the Securities and Exchange Commission, and the President's Council of Economic Advisers. Outside of the public sector, NERA experts have held senior positions at some of the world's leading financial and advisory companies.

We combine an authoritative understanding of the relevant laws and regulations with the industry's leading experience in producing highly rigorous and objective economic analysis.

In the area of consumer financial services, NERA experts have experience with:

  • Allegations of unfair, deceptive, or abusive acts or practices (UDAAP) and unfair or deceptive acts or practices (UDAP)
  • Analysis of transactional deposit account, consumer loan, and servicing data
  • Fair lending
  • Assisting with preparation of responses to NORA Notices, PARR Letters, and Civil Investigative Demands (CID)
  • Disputes between financial services providers and vendors
  • Allegations of excessive mortgage and credit card fees
  • TILA disclosures
  • Analysis related to restitution
  • Analysis of antitrust issues in relation to payments infrastructure
  • Economic analysis, both theoretical and empirical, of consumer financial protection regulations and policy
